That was the Mecklenburg County District 1 Republican candidate Aaron Marin, and he has dropped out of the race.
He didn't drop out because politics got inconvenient. He dropped out because his home and vehicle were shot up while his family was inside the house.
This is for a county seat. In Huntersville, North Carolina.
Drive-bys are hitting the suburbs now.
And the man quit the race because he didn't want to be killed.
That sentence should make every normal American stop what they're doing.
We are not talking about a presidential campaign. We are not talking about some national celebrity politician with a security detail and handlers who wear earpieces. This was a county race.
And yet the threat was real enough that a man looked at public service, looked at his family, looked at the bullet holes, and said, "No office is worth this."
